Mechanics of Tooth Movement



Comprehending exactly how teeth move during orthodontic treatment is essential for both orthodontists and clients to realize the mechanics of tooth activity. When pressure is related to a tooth, it initiates a process called bone makeover. This procedure includes the failure and restoring of bone tissue to allow the tooth to move into its proper setting. The stress applied by braces or aligners triggers a cascade of occasions within the gum ligament, bring about the repositioning of the tooth.

Tooth movement occurs in feedback to the force applied and the body's natural reaction to that pressure. As the tooth steps, bone is resorbed on one side and transferred on the other. This constant cycle of bone remodeling permits the tooth to change progressively over time. Orthodontists very carefully plan the direction and amount of pressure required to achieve the wanted activity, taking into consideration variables such as tooth root size and bone thickness.

Technologies in Modern Orthodontics



To explore the developments in orthodontic care, allow's look into the cutting-edge modern technologies used in modern-day orthodontics. In recent times, the field of orthodontics has seen impressive technical innovations that have changed the way teeth are straightened and lined up. Among one of the most substantial advancements is the intro of clear aligner systems like Invisalign. These custom-made aligners are virtually unseen and use an even more very discreet option to traditional braces.

Furthermore, developments in 3D imaging technology have allowed orthodontists to develop precise therapy strategies tailored to each person's unique dental framework. Cone beam of light computed tomography (CBCT) scans supply thorough 3D images of the teeth, roots, and jaw, enabling even more accurate diagnosis and treatment.



Another remarkable innovation in contemporary orthodontics is the use of increased orthodontics strategies. These methods, such as AcceleDent and Propel, help accelerate the tooth activity procedure, lowering treatment time dramatically.
